TensorFlow and PyTorch are two of the most widely used open-source deep learning frameworks. TensorFlow, developed by Google, emphasizes production deployment and scalability, offering a comprehensive ecosystem for machine learning tasks. PyTorch, developed by Facebook's AI Research lab, is known for its ease of use, dynamic computation graph, and flexibility, making it especially popular among researchers and developers for rapid prototyping.
Key Features
- Open-source and widely adopted in industry and academia
- Support for building complex neural networks with high performance
- Flexible APIs that cater to both beginners and advanced users
- Extensive community support and vast libraries/model zoos
- Hardware acceleration through GPU/TPU compatibility
- Tools for model training, deployment, and visualization
Pros
- Robust ecosystem with mature tools and libraries
- Strong community support and frequent updates
- High flexibility for research experimentation (especially PyTorch)
- Excellent performance optimization features
- Ease of integration with other AI/machine learning tools
Cons
- Steeper learning curve for beginners (particularly TensorFlow before version 2.0)
- Complexity can sometimes lead to less intuitive debugging (more so in TensorFlow)
- PyTorch's deployment options were historically less mature but have improved recently
- Resource-intensive development environment requiring good hardware
